
Women’s Basketball Signee Chloe Spreen Named 2024 Indiana Miss Basketball
3/15/2024 9:35:00 AM | Women's Basketball
The Crimson Tide’s signee was recognized as the state’s top high school girls basketball player
TUSCALOOSA, Ala. – Alabama women's basketball signee Chloe Spreen has been named the 2024 Indiana Miss Basketball – a senior-only award given to the best high school girls basketball player in the state. Spreen is the first Bedford North Lawrence High School player to receive the award since 2019 and third overall in school history.
Chloe Spreen Notes
- The Bedford, Ind., native, is rated as a 4-star recruit by ProspectsNation.com
- Spreen recently was named to the Indiana All-Star Team
- As one of only two returners on the Bedford North Lawrence Stars team, the senior helped lead squad to a 20-5 record and its 13th-consecutive IHSAA Class 4A sectional title
- Spreen averaged 20.9 points per game and 6.9 rebounds per game during her senior year
- Earned 1,869 career points, which ranks as the second highest on the school's all-time scoring list
- For the Stars, Spreen finished with 633 rebounds, 259 assists, 200 steals and 62 blocks
